Making Alarms More Musical Can Save Lives Medical alarms don’t have to be louder to be more effective

Sounds that were percussive, with complex time-varied harmonic overtones, like a xylophone's ping are considered least annoying whilst commanding attention!

New article in collab w/ Johanna Boardman and the Drummond team at Monash.
*Awareness of errors is reduced by sleep loss*

Perhaps one of sleep loss's most dangerous effects: not only are you more prone to errors but you might not even realize it!
